There is a Kerberized Popper available, which uses kerberos tickets
net-dist.mit.edu:pub/pop/popper-1.7k.tar.Z -- as the README-FIRST says, this is for convenience of people picking up Techmail or Techmail-S (kerberized pop3 mailreaders, for the mac, the -S version is for SLIP I'm pretty sure. PC version was just released, I think...) I've heard rumour of a kerberized Eudora, that would interoperate with this code, but haven't seen it. mh-6.8 (and higher) will interoperate with this if you enable KPOP (and probably ATHENA and one or two other things.) There's also an emacs-movemail that has KERBEROS ifdef's. _Mark_ <eichin@paycheck.cygnus.com> ... just me at home ... ps. This is all Kerberos 4-based stuff. The popper, movemail, and pop-from are included in the Cygnus Network Security package (along with the rest of Kerberos 4 :-)
